Algeria - Agricultural Land Area
Since 2014, Algeria Agricultural Land Area decreased by 0points year on year. With 17.38 Percent of Land Area in 2019, the country was ranked number 172 comparing other countries in Agricultural Land Area. Algeria is overtaken by Montenegro, which was ranked number 171 with 17.4 Percent of Land Area and is followed by Saint Lucia at 17.16 Percent of Land Area. Falkland Islands ranked the highest with 93.7 Percent of Land Area in 2019, a decrease of 0.1points versus 2018. Saudi Arabia, Lesotho and Kazakhstan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. San Marino witnessed the best average annual growth at +19.5points per year, while Barbados witnessed the worst performance at -4.7points per year.
